Lighter apple & pear pie

Try a low fat version of this family favourite. Filo pastry is light and crispy, and bulk out the filling with pears

Ingredients

6 serv.
  • eating apples6

    (we used Braeburn)

  • ripe pears4
  • zest and juice 1 lemon
  • agave syrup3 tbsp tbsp
  • mixed spice1 tsp tsp
  • cornflour1 tbsp tbsp
  • filo pastry4

    sheets

  • rapeseed oil4 tsp tsp
  • flaked almond25g g
  • custard

    (made with custard powder and skimmed milk), fat-free Greek yogurt or low-fat frozen vanilla yogurt

Step-by-step instructions

  1. 1

    Peel, core, and chop the apples and pears into large pieces, and throw into a big saucepan with the lemon juice, agave syrup, mixed spice and 200ml water. Bring to a simmer with the lid on, then take off the lid and cook, stirring, for about 5 mins until the apple is softening. Use a slotted spoon to scoop out three-quarters of the fruit chunks and put into a pie dish.

  2. 2

    Cover and cook the remaining fruit for another 4-5 mins until soft, then mash with a potato masher. Mix 1 tbsp of this with the cornflour to a smooth paste, then add back to the pan and bring back to a simmer, stirring, to thicken the sauce. Pour over the fruit in the pie dish and stir together.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4.

  3. 3

    Lay out your sheets of filo and brush all over with oil – 1 tsp should be enough for 1 sheet. Scatter over the almonds and press to stick to the pastry, then crumple up each sheet as you lift it on top of the fruit. Bake for 20-25 mins until the pastry is browned and crisp. Serve straight away.
